Transaction 38aa395e015514cfe21bb0736fbba19159e891ec356674e7cae5a61fee22d776
1 Input
1 Output
-
38aa395e015514cfe21bb0736fbba19159e891ec356674e7cae5a61fee22d776:0
- value
- 17694400
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 77ee95e5f057e248f1db76fdd743022909013ae0 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Bw9E3RS9EjE19hqkyuwJEhd9KtumiRQNV